Applications of Mini Sewer Cameras in Plumbing When experiencing poor quality video recordings on your mini sewer camera, one of the common culprits could be insufficient storage space on the device. Checking the storage space available is essential to ensure smooth and clear video recording during inspections. To address this issue, start by deleting any unnecessary files or footage that may be occupying precious storage on the device. Regularly clearing the storage space can help prevent video quality deterioration and maintain optimal performance during sewer inspections.Ensuring Longevity and Optimal Performance

Training Requirements for Crawler Sewer Camera Operators Mini Sewer Camera Cable Connection Issue    Pan-and-Tilt Sewer Camera Features and Functions Advantages of Mini Sewer Cameras When dealing with a mini sewer camera cable connection issue, the most common culprit is a loose or inadequate connection between the camera and the monitor. This can lead to a loss of signal or poor video quality. To address this issue, ensure that the camera cable is securely connected to both the camera unit and the monitor. Double-check that the connection is tight and that there are no visible signs of damage to the cable or ports.Evaluating Initial Investment vs. Longterm Savings
Innovations in Crawler Sewer Camera Systems Another common problem related to cable connections is damage to the cable itself. Over time, the cable can become worn or frayed, leading to a loss of connection or interference with the video feed. If you suspect that the cable is the issue, it may be necessary to replace it with a new one. Prioritize using high-quality replacement cables to ensure a stable and reliable connection between the camera and the monitor.Training Requirements for Operating Pushrod Sewer Cameras

    MaintenMini Sewer Camera LED Lights Not Working    When the LED lights on your mini sewer camera are not functioning properly, it can greatly impede your ability to effectively inspect pipes and identify issues. One common reason for this issue is that the LED lights may be worn out or damaged due to prolonged use. In such cases, replacing the LED lights with new ones can often resolve the problem and restore proper functionality to the camera.How do pushrod sewer cameras compare to other types of sewer cameras?
Another possible cause for the LED lights not working could be a loose connection or a faulty component in the camera unit. It is important to carefully inspect the camera and its components to ensure that all connections are secure and free of any damage. Cost considerations for pushrod sewer cameras are crucial when assessing the financial investment required for such equipment. Pushrod cameras generally offer a more affordable option compared to other types of sewer cameras. However, the initial cost can vary depending on the brand, features, and specifications of the camera. It is important for users to carefully evaluate their specific needs and budget constraints before selecting a pushrod sewer camera.Mini Sewer Cameras vs. Traditional Inspection Methods

Upgrading Your PanandTilt Sewer Camera SystemRelated LinksIn addition to the initial purchase cost, users should also factor in maintenance and repair expenses when calculating the total cost of ownership for pushrod sewer cameras. Regular maintenance and timely repairs are essential to ensure the longevity and optimal performance of the equipment. By investing in proper upkeep and servicing, users can extend the lifespan of their pushrod sewer cameras and avoid costly breakdowns in the future.Mini Sewer Cameras: Choosing the Right Model for Your Needs
